Transaction 3d5d92ba093a0bc010ce9fa0556f601216d8a63cca062cd51ba350fbe7f57478

12 Input
2 Outputs
  • 3d5d92ba093a0bc010ce9fa0556f601216d8a63cca062cd51ba350fbe7f57478:0
  • value  21347130
    address  13H1rPYTyNQXdp4cPttuFoX3BADbF6KHei
  • 3d5d92ba093a0bc010ce9fa0556f601216d8a63cca062cd51ba350fbe7f57478:1
  • value  1002583
    address  35B6UKGnLizbRfq7WkgrCYWB3EDXWbgcEm